Full Job Description

Back of House Manager
Company: Chick-fil-A
Location: Chicago, IL

Description:
A Back of House Manager is one who consistently demonstrates our core values, embraces the Chick-fil-A culture and has a servant's heart. They have a passion for people and serving others, have strong character, take initiative and work with a sense of urgency at all times. Our Shift Managers are responsible for supporting senior leadership in executing daily operations and keeping team members accountable for each component of Operational Excellence and our Recipe for Service. A Shift Manager's two main areas of focus are completing tasks so that the restaurant runs effectively, and coaching/developing team members. Shift Managers lead by example and set the tone that others will follow.
